This work presents a critical examination of Napoleon Bonaparte through the lens of Victor Hugo's sharp commentary. The author explores themes of tyranny, heroism, and the impact of Napoleon's rule on France and its citizens. Hugo's passionate prose reveals his disdain for the dictator while reflecting on the broader implications of power and freedom. The book serves not only as a historical account but also as a poignant critique of the moral and ethical dilemmas faced during Napoleon's reign.
